What is the success rate for athletes returning to their profession after hip replacement, and how early can they resume training and sport?

Asked by Dr. Dinaw (Ethiopia)

It depends on the pathology and the type of activity. A well-selected hip replacement lets most patients resume daily activities and many general activities, but for physically demanding sports like football or basketball a total hip replacement is not really compatible with returning to the same sport, and changing to a less demanding sport is usually the better path. Where the underlying problem is femoroacetabular impingement rather than true arthritis, hip arthroscopy to clean up the impingement and cartilage, combined with stem cell therapy, allows the hip to regenerate over about six months with good results on repeat MRI.

In patients with advanced hip osteoarthritis who have pain but still have sufficient mobility, is there a place for conservative management, and when should surgery be recommended?

Asked by Jivo Doctor Partner (name unclear from transcript)

The X-ray tells the story: if the joint space and cartilage are still maintained, surgery is not the first answer even if pain has started. Arthroscopic cleanup of osteochondral bone formation or damaged cartilage combined with stem cell therapy is a good option at that stage. Hip replacement is reserved for once the cartilage is completely damaged and there is no blood flow left to the femoral head.

Do you have expertise in hip arthroplasty for children with sickle cell disease, and is hip replacement recommended in children generally?

Asked by Dr. Stephen Cope (Cameroon)

Hip arthroplasty is not recommended below 17 to 18 years of age because the skeleton has not matured. For sickle cell disease specifically, bone marrow transplant, ideally done early in childhood, remains the standard curative treatment and gives the best results. In children who do need hip intervention before that age, arthroscopy and osteotomy techniques that reshape the weight-bearing surface of the hip are used instead of replacement, relieving pain while the child grows.

How long can patients generally expect their hip implants to last, and what factors influence the longevity of these implants?

Asked by Dr. Andrew Odin

A well-fitted hip replacement lasts 30 to 35 years, and since most hip replacement candidates are older, most will not need it again in their lifetime. Longevity depends on the patient avoiding certain positions and activities that stress the implant, including sitting cross-legged or squatting on the floor, and avoiding high-energy sport activity.

Can you briefly describe how stem cell therapy is used in hip disorders?

Asked by Dr. William Gadaga (Zimbabwe)

Stem cells are osteoprogenitor cells capable of turning into bone, cartilage or other tissue types. For damaged islands of hip cartilage, the area is cleaned up arthroscopically and stem cells are injected. On follow-up MRI over about six months, the cartilage visibly starts regrowing, similar to grass regrowing, and the damaged area shrinks along with the patient's symptoms.

How are these stem cells harvested, and how long does the harvesting process take?

Asked by Dr. William Gadaga (Zimbabwe)

In orthopaedics, stem cells are harvested from the iliac crest using a Jamshidi needle, taking around 120 ml of bone marrow blood from either a posterior or anterior approach to the pelvis. This is then centrifuged for around 45 minutes to an hour to concentrate the stem cells before they are injected.
